What is the differentance between the gorilla and the frog?

Gorillas are large, herbivorous primates found in Africa, while frogs are small, amphibious animals found worldwide. Gorillas have a muscular build and are predominantly terrestrial, while frogs have a slimy skin and typically live near water. Gorillas are mammals, while frogs are amphibians with a unique life cycle that involves metamorphosis.

How big are gorillas' feet?

Gorillas have large feet that can measure up to 12 inches (about 30 centimeters) in length. Their feet are broad and designed to support their heavy weight, with long toes that help them grip surfaces while climbing or walking. The size and structure of their feet are adapted for their primarily terrestrial lifestyle, allowing for stability and balance.


Do gorillas live in caves?

Gorillas do not typically live in caves. They construct nests on the ground made of leaves and branches to sleep in at night. They may occasionally seek shelter in caves or other natural cavities during bad weather or for protection.

What are gorillas geographic distribution?

Scientists believe that there are two species of gorillas: Eastern gorillas (Gorilla beringei) and Western gorillas (Gorilla gorilla).In each species there are two subspecies.Eastern gorillas: Mountain gorillas (Gorilla beringei beringei), and Lowland gorillas (Gorilla gorilla graueri).Western gorillas: Lowland gorillas (Gorilla gorilla gorilla) and Nigerian gorillas (Gorilla gorilla diehli).Gorillas only exist in equatorial Africa in the following countries:CameroonCentral African RepublicDemocratic Republic of CongoGabonGuineaNigeriaRwandaUganda
